When It’s Time to Get Your Air Conditioner Repaired

Is the level of comfort in your home disappointing what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le issues that, if neglected, might result in more severe repair work or the need for an early replacement of your a/c unit. While a unit that will not switch on is a clear sign that you need repair work, there are other, less obvious issues. If you are familiar with the more subtle indications of a problem with your cooling, you will have the ability to contact a expert service specialist sooner rather than later.

If any of the following use, one of our AC repair experts encourages that you give us a call:

  • You are sustaining an increase in the quantity of cash needed to spend for your monthly energy bills: Inefficient operation of your a/c can be brought on by a number of different concerns, consisting of leaking ductwork, an internal malfunction, or a defective thermostat. This means that it needs to work more difficult to keep your property cool, which will result in a considerable boost in the amount that you pay in utility bills.
  • You only discover hot air coming out of your vents: First things first, ensure you have not inadvertently set the thermostat to the inaccurate temperature level by checking it. If that is not the case, then you probably have a issue on the inside of your a/c unit, and you need to get it checked by a professional.
  • You are seeing a higher humidity level at your residential or commercial property: Even though this is not the main function of your air conditioning unit, it is accountable for controling the humidity level inside of your home or industrial structure. Higher humidity shows that there is an excess of moisture in the air, which can cause the growth of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is important that you get this matter resolved as quickly as humanly practical, particularly for the sake of your safety.
  • The air flow in your unit is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ide variety of aspects that can result in inadequate airflow. We will need to carry out a detailed inspection in order to figure out whether the issue is the outcome of a blocked air filter, an problem with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, dripping ductwork, or blocked duct.
  • You observe that there is a significant amount of moisture in the location around your system: Condensation is a natural incident, nevertheless it should not be present in excessive quantities. It is possible that you have a dripping refrigerant or a stopped up drain tube if you notice any excess wetness or pooling water in the location.
  • Strange Noises from Your Unit: It is to be expected for an air conditioner to develop some background noise while it is running. On the other hand, if it starts making audible shrieking, screeching, grinding, groaning, or scraping sounds, this is an obvious indicator that something needs to be fixed.
  • It appears that there is a issue with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the issues you’re having with your ac system. If you have hot and cold areas around your home, your system will not shut off, or it won’t begin, it could be because of a problem with the thermostat. If your unit will not start, it might also be because it won’t turn off.
  • Foul odors are originating from your system: There may be a issue with your air conditioning if you smell anything burning or a moldy smell. These smells can be brought on by a variety of elements, including mold advancement and charred electrical wiring.
  • Your system rotates typically between the following states: When the temperature inside your home reaches the level that you have actually chosen on the thermostat, air conditioners are programmed to turn off instantly. Despite this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something incorrect with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ises

There are a few sounds that should not be heard coming from air conditioners despite the fact that they do not run completely silence. These sounds might be anything from a banging to a screeching to a grinding to a clicking sound. These specific sounds almost always show that there is a problem within the cooling unit that needs to be repaired by a specialist of in .

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your a/c The following need to be included:

  • Banging: The problem is typically the compressor in an a/c that is making a banging noise. This element of the air conditioning unit is responsible for providing refrigerant to the different other components of the unit in order to remove excess heat from your home. Compressor components might relax as the a/c system ages. This sound is brought on by the parts walking around and rattling and banging into one another.
  • Shrieking: A damaged blower fan motor within the a/c unit might produce a sound similar to shrieking or squealing if the motor is working improperly. Typically, a faulty fan belt or broken bearings in the motor are to blame for this noise. Switch off the AC right now and connect with a professional for repairs whenever you hear a shrieking noise.
  • Grinding: The noise of something grinding is never ever a excellent indication to hear coming from any kind of mechanical things. Pistons inside the compressor might have worn, which might lead to this grinding noise originating from the AC.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it generally suggests that the compressor itself has to be changed. The complete air conditioning unit might need to be changed depending on the design of air conditioner and how old it is.
  • Clicking: It is extremely common for an air conditioning unit to make a clicking sound when it at first turns on. If you hear clicking throughout the entire duration of the cooling cycle, then there is a problem with the clicking. These clicks are the result of a thermostat that is not working properly.
